简单地说,我正在尝试制作一个简单的搜索引擎,其中有一个 MySQL 数据库,其内容显示在 HTML 表格上(使用 PHP 获取信息),我想制作一个搜索栏当您键入时,会自动过滤列表。 我找到了有关如何使用纯文本制作该内容的教程,其中它仅显示在列表中,但没有介绍如何过滤已显示的表格。
如果有人可以向我指出一些有用的链接,或者一些我可以用来开始我的代码,那就太好了,抱歉,如果之前已经回答过这个问题,我已经找了 20 多分钟了只是找不到任何有效的东西。
TLDR:创建一个搜索栏,当您键入时,会过滤一个 HTML 表格,其中填充了通过 PHP 代码带到页面上的 MySQL 数据库表格信息,之后找不到任何教程或有用的链接/代码经过 20 分钟的搜索,终于来到这里。
最佳答案
这是通过 AJAX 完成的。如果你想在用户输入时实时显示它,你必须使用 javascript。既然您想朝正确的方向拍摄,那么可以去这里: http://www.w3schools.com/php/php_ajax_php.asp
您将需要使用 SQL 来填充您案例中的数组。
关于php - HTML 表的即时搜索栏,包含 MySQL 表中的信息,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/38092075/